§ 66-7-366 — Occupied moving house trailer

New Mexico·Ch. 66 Motor Vehicles·Art. 7 Traffic Laws; Signs, Signals and Markings; Accidents;
It is a misdemeanor for any person to: A. occupy a house trailer while it is being towed upon a highway; or B. tow a house trailer on any highway when the house trailer is occupied by any person.
